Economy & Jobs
Charlevoix residents earn a median household income of $52,344 , which is 30%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$56,573. The unemployment rate stands at 3.4% (6%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 19.0%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 599 business establishments, including 60 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in Charlevoix is $294,400 , 4% above the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$420,579. Median rent is $880/month, with 34.3%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 96.2 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1966.
Safety & Crime
Charlevoix reports 400 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 5% above the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 1,441/100K. The murder rate is 0.0/100K.
Education
31.8% of adults in Charlevoix hold a bachelor's degree or higher (6% below the national average). 96.9%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.6/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
Charlevoix has an average annual temperature of 46°F (8°C). Winters average 23°F in January while summers reach 69°F in July. The area gets 270 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 33.7 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 38.
